This is a newly created role due to growth. You will be joining a team of Software Development Engineers and work on a variety of projects such as improving the build pipeline, ensuring the successful delivery of new releases, and ensuring HA and redundancy.
You are a DevOps Engineer looking for a new challenge and opportunity. Your experience includes AWS, Ansible, Python, and familiarity with relational SQL databases (ideally MySQL). You enjoy collaborating with the team and initiating or supporting the use of new tools and technology.
What You Will Be Doing:
You will be responsible for the reliability, security, efficiency, and scalability of cloud deployments. Participate in the Development Operations team activities including continuous delivery, configuration changes, and performance monitoring. Manage and monitor cloud resources utilization and cost.
- Operate, scale, and troubleshoot applications and infrastructure
- Use and develop tools for systems continuous delivery automation
- System Administration on Linux and macOS operating systems, network configurations, access and permissions, and AWS cloud services
- Ensure cloud environment reliability, performance and safety of information
- Ensure high availability and performance of cloud deployments
- Define and implement effective cloud infrastructure, services, applications and customer connectivity monitoring and emergency alerting
- Ensure secure and managed access to production and staging environments
- Work with engineering, security operations, software architecture, support, platform, and other cross-functional teams on company priorities and roadmap planning for a rapidly growing customer base
- Monitor cloud resources utilization and associated costs
- Interact with vendors, consultants, and partners to ensure that cloud operations meet the needs of all users of the platform
What You Need for this Position:
- 5+ years professional software development experience
- 3+ years and a proven record of success in administration of cloud infrastructure and deployed applications for enterprise SaaS or PaaS companies in public clouds such as AWS, GCP, Azure
- 5+ years of experience in administration of IT systems
- 3+ years and a proven record of success of using and creating automated delivery and configuration tools
- 3+ years and a proven record of success in monitoring of cloud infrastructure and SaaS or PaaS applications
- 24x7x365 shift-based support with rotating on-call (1-2 times per week)
- Strong knowledge of cloud infrastructure
- Solid foundation in Linux/Windows operating systems and tools
- Strong knowledge of IT infrastructure including routers, firewalls, VPNs, IDS, IPS, Proxy, etc
- Proficient with DevOps tools and environments
- Proficient with scripting languages like Python, PowerShell, Bash
- Experience with centralized logging services like Papertrail and CloudWatch
- Experience with monitoring tools like StackDriver, NewRelic, Graphite, Nagios, Zabbix
- Understanding of cybersecurity methodology such as security controls, access control and auditing
- Experience with AWS platform tools like APIGW, CloudFormation, ECS, EC2, Fargate, Lambda Functions, Step Functions, VPC, etc.
- Advanced experience with DevOps methodology and Continuous Delivery
- Experience in migrating products from on premise to cloud
- Experience with security of sensitive personal data
Bachelor's degree in Information Systems, Computer Science, Engineering or related field
- Competitive wages.
- Medical, dental and vision benefits after 90 days.
- Free lunch every two weeks.
Kater has a track record of promoting from within so if you are interested in leadership or technical career paths, you will have both options to consider. We are centrally located near transit in downtown Vancouver.
Please note: Candidates need to be authorized to work in Canada and available for interviews in Vancouver.